Here is an image of a photo by Edward Kaspriske that was taken in Northumberland, Pennsylvania, in 1956. Shown here is Pennsylvania Railroad engine #7562, an H-10S (2-8-0) "Consolidated" built by the American Locomotive Company during September of 1913 and retired around 1956. Partially visible at the left is PRR engine #5750, an AP-20 built by ALCo in October of 1947, rated at 2,000 horsepower, later regeared and reclassified as an AFP-20, and retired in September of 1962.
